Atomfair 4-Nitrophenyl Acetate PNP-Acetate, p-NPA, NA C8H7NO4 CAS 830-03-5
4-Nitrophenyl Acetate (CAS: 830-03-5) is a high-purity biochemical reagent widely used in enzymatic assays and research applications. This compound, with the molecular formula C8H7NO4, serves as a chromogenic substrate for esterases, lipases, and other hydrolytic enzymes, producing the yellow-colored 4-nitrophenol upon cleavage. Its excellent stability and sensitivity make it ideal for kinetic studies, enzyme characterization, and high-throughput screening. Supplied as a crystalline solid, our 4-Nitrophenyl Acetate is rigorously tested to ensure ≥99% purity (GC) and is packaged under inert conditions to maintain integrity. Suitable for laboratory use only.

Properties
- CAS Number: 830-03-5
- Complexity: 203
- IUPAC Name: (4-nitrophenyl) acetate
- InChI: InChI=1S/C8H7NO4/c1-6(10)13-8-4-2-7(3-5-8)9(11)12/h2-5H,1H3
- InChI Key: QAUUDNIGJSLPSX-UHFFFAOYSA-N
- Exact Mass: 181.03750770
- Molecular Formula: C8H7NO4
- Molecular Weight: 181.15
- SMILES: CC(=O)OC1=CC=C(C=C1)[N+](=O)[O-]
- Topological: 72.1
- Monoisotopic Mass: 181.03750770
- Physical Description: White crystalline solid;
- Vapor Pressure: 0.00186 [mmHg]

4-Nitrophenyl Acetate is primarily employed as a substrate for detecting esterase and lipase activity in biochemical assays. It is commonly used in enzyme kinetics studies due to its ability to release 4-nitrophenol, which can be quantified spectrophotometrically at 405 nm. This compound is also utilized in diagnostic applications and pharmaceutical research to evaluate enzyme inhibitors. Its high sensitivity and stability make it a preferred choice for both academic and industrial laboratories.
Safety and Hazards
GHS Hazard Statements
- H272 (100%): May intensify fire; oxidizer [Danger Oxidizing liquids; Oxidizing solids]
- H317 (100%): May cause an allergic skin reaction [Warning Sensitization, Skin]
- H318 (100%): Causes serious eye damage [Danger Serious eye damage/eye irritation]
Precautionary Statements
- P210, P220, P261, P264+P265, P272, P280, P302+P352, P305+P354+P338, P317, P321, P333+P317, P362+P364, P370+P378, and P501
Hazard Classes and Categories
- Ox. Sol. 3 (100%)
- Skin Sens. 1 (100%)
- Eye Dam. 1 (100%)
